Where is CX Turin Marconi?
Where is CX Turin Marconi located?
CX Turin Marconi, CX Turin Marconi, Italy (approx. 45.05414°, 7.6784°)
Where is CX Turin Marconi on the map?
{"latitude":45.05414,"longitude":7.6784,"title":"CX Turin Marconi"}